Johnstoniini is a tribe of flesh flies within the Sarcophagidae, comprising approximately 7 and 12 described . The tribe includes the genera Camptops, Erucophaga, Harpagopyga, Johnstonia, Lepidodexia, Rafaelia, and Sthenopyga. Members of this tribe are classified under the order Diptera and are part of the diverse of sarcophagid flies.

Taxonomic Note

The Catalogue of Life lists Johnstoniini as a synonym of a , but this conflicts with the accepted tribal rank in Sarcophagidae per ITIS, GBIF, and iNaturalist. The tribal classification under Sarcophagidae is the currently accepted treatment.
